Output 7bab3f60693db94c1c6d36e2067bb829f56108186338068d22e79bda0527be29:1

value
100576000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ecaaa826841ef84c43b4dd2ece9754d03775f7c5 OP_EQUAL
address
AE1ea797qKJP9yRXA76cFaceUHreJm2c64
transaction
7bab3f60693db94c1c6d36e2067bb829f56108186338068d22e79bda0527be29